]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commit
osd/PG: handle deletes in MissingLoc
authorJosh Durgin <jdurgin@redhat.com>
Mon, 26 Jun 2017 22:14:02 +0000 (18:14 -0400)
committerJosh Durgin <jdurgin@redhat.com>
Mon, 17 Jul 2017 06:00:35 +0000 (02:00 -0400)
commit3a9d056d843bcafd26d78950b84e2844f8a3a9a1
tree99edeb54ac1d8b7e2f618b2a896ac8642c9c3fe4
parentfa037fb863532bca8de90a34042f3fe5162b46f2
osd/PG: handle deletes in MissingLoc

There's no source needed for deleting an object, so don't keep track
of this. Update is_readable_with_acting/is_unfound, and add an
is_deleted() method to be used later.

Signed-off-by: Josh Durgin <jdurgin@redhat.com>
src/osd/PG.cc
src/osd/PG.h